2. Showing Off in Initial Public Offerings: The Proportion of Institutional Cornerstone Investors in IPOs and the State of the IPO Market
C-uppsats, Handelshögskolan i Stockholm/Institutionen för finansiell ekonomiSammanfattning : The paper analyzes the participation of institutional cornerstone investors in initial public offerings (IPOs) using data from NASDAQ Main Market and First North Growth Market in Stockholm between 2015 and the first half of 2023. We identify positive relationships between both hot and cold IPO market periods and the proportion of institutional cornerstone investors in IPOs. LÄS MER

4. Hot Bull or Cold Bear? How Market Cycles Affect IPO Underpricing
C-uppsats, Handelshögskolan i Stockholm/Institutionen för finansiell ekonomiSammanfattning : IPO underpricing and its variability is highly cyclical and follows waves, with "hot" and "cold" IPO markets displaying radically different characteristics. Further, during the 21st century, the effect of bear-, and bull markets on stock prices increased. LÄS MER
